Defines the requirements a device must meet to claim IPMX HKEP support, and the behaviors evaluated to verify it. HKEP is the protocol IPMX uses to carry HDCP-protected content over an IP network.

Defines the requirements a device must meet to claim IPMX PEP support, and the behaviors evaluated to verify it. PEP is the protocol IPMX uses to encrypt and authenticate media streams, so that only Receivers holding the correct pre-shared key can access content on the network.
